Osmanthus Alley

Osmanthus Alley

Year: 1987

Runtime: 112 mins

Language: Chinese

Director: Chen Kun-Hou

Drama

After losing both parents at twelve, Ti Hung vows at sixteen to escape her destitution. Through relentless effort she masters embroidery, gaining fame and wealth, which leads to a marriage into an affluent family—only for unforeseen tragedy to strike, reshaping her life.

Timeline – Osmanthus Alley (1987)

1

Orphaned and Raised

Ti-Hung and her younger brother Ti-Jiang are left motherless while still young. Ti-Hung takes on the role of guardian for Ti-Jiang, while their aunt and uncle oversee them. The loss shapes her early responsibilities and the burden of growing up quickly.

early 1900s, childhood village
2

A Match with Rui Yu

As Ti-Hung grows into a skilled embroiderer with bound feet, Lady Li of North Gate notices her talent and arranges a marriage to Rui Yu, the wealthy grandson. A fellow villager and poor fisherman, Ah Hai, also harbors affection for Ti-Hung. The marriage promises escape from poverty.

early 1900s, youth village / Lady Li's home
3

The Cut Palm Fate

Ti-Hung overhears a conversation about the Cut Palm fate, learning that a woman with this fate is a jinx to the men in her life. The superstition unsettles her and foreshadows the strain she will face. This belief seeds the tension in her future choices.

youth village
4

Ti-Jiang's Death

Ti-Jiang drowns while out fishing, leaving Ti-Hung alone to shoulder family responsibilities. His death deepens her resolve to secure a stable future for herself. The loss marks a turning point toward the arranged marriage with Rui Yu.

shortly after youth fishing area
5

Marriage to Rui Yu

Ti-Hung agrees to marry Rui Yu, hoping that joining the wealthy Hsin family will lift her family out of poverty. The wedding ties her to a life of privilege but also sets up new pressures. The union is a turning point from her earlier guardian role toward a new social identity.

early 1900s Hsin family home / village
6

Birth of Hui Chih and Rui Yu's Death

Ti-Hung gives birth to a son, Hui Chih, but Rui Yu dies of pneumonia soon after, leaving Ti-Hung a widow at a relatively young age. She becomes the sole guardian of Hui Chih and faces the family’s fragility. The loss triggers her protective, sometimes harsh, management of the household.

shortly after marriage Hsin family home
7

Uncle's Management and Monk's Prediction

Rui Yu's uncle manages the family accounts, while Ti-Hung grows protective of Hui Chih. She blames her bad fate for Rui Yu's death and learns from a monk's prediction that Rui Yu's life would be short, which oddly relieves her guilt.

after Rui Yu's death home, accounts
8

Rise as Mistress of the Family

Ti-Hung embraces wealth and leisure, becoming enamored with opera and neglecting her duties as a mother. Her personal maid hints that the family is slowly unraveling under her inattentiveness. The erstwhile caregiver shifts into a controlling matriarch.

mid-life home
9

Chun Shu and the Downfall

After the uncle dies and Ti-Hung attends his wake, she falls into opium use and begins an affair with Chun Shu, the young servant. When Chun Shu becomes cocky, she engineers his theft and has him imprisoned to silence him.

post-wake wake, home
10

Pregnancy and Secrecy

Ti-Hung discovers she is pregnant and tries to hide the pregnancy while Hui Chih visits. He comforts her and proposes taking her to Japan to deliver away from gossip. The newborn is later adopted in Japan.

late period before adoption Japan (delivery) / hometown
11

Return Home and Blessings

Back in her hometown, Ti-Hung worries for Hsin Yue's youth and marriageability. Hsin Yue reveals a dowry prepared for her, and Ah Chu—the staff she once fired for leading Hui Chih astray—proposes; Ti-Hung blesses the match.

after pregnancy hometown
12

Decades Later and Ah Hai's Rise

Decades pass and Ti-Hung, now in her 70s and aging, discovers Ah Hai has risen from fisherman to a wealthy, influential businessman. Her son Hui Chih has become a busy delegate for the Japanese, rarely visiting.

late life temple, hometown
13

Final Years and Death

Ti-Hung's memory of her youth returns as time winds down; she dies peacefully alone, surrounded by wealth yet without lasting companionship. The final scenes flash back to her youth as she passes away.

old age home among riches
